Columns and beams do not need to be checked for torsional-flexural buckling if they fall within the limits of the slenderness ratio or when the height-to-breadth ratio of these sections does not exceed 2 to 1. ![]() When used as beams, the need for lateral support is reduced. High flexural stiffness in all directions is combined with high torsional stiffness.
